Transaction 8601537e1aaa020dce690dcfe37bf883bbe36c9ee238f86744d1f44dac203d09
2 Input
2 Outputs
- 8601537e1aaa020dce690dcfe37bf883bbe36c9ee238f86744d1f44dac203d09:0
- 8601537e1aaa020dce690dcfe37bf883bbe36c9ee238f86744d1f44dac203d09:1
value 66933000
address 32uHsoUXznuWSMea9EhhB2YvHsf77yqb2H
value 1657740826
address 3CswTd6V8V2uv24P9yWHpPnFiLfN4CABgW